scattering coefficient
A measure of the extinction due to scattering of monochromatic radiation as it traverses a medium containing scattering particles. Usually expressed as a volume scattering coefficient with units of reciprocal length (i.e., area per unit volume), but also as a mass scattering coefficient with units of area per unit mass.
